Eva was a nurse for over 40 years, starting her career as a Lieutenant Nurse in the Army for 3 years and then climbing through the civilian nursing ranks while finally completing her career as Nurse Administrator at NYU Langone Hospital in New York City. She loved to travel, garden, cook, and spend time on her computer shopping for her family. Eva loved art and had an incredibly creative sense; she was always interested in design and fashion, and had great style. Above all, Eva loved to look after others with a fierce generosity of spirit and will be missed by all.
Eva is survived by her partner Marian; children Evie and Brie and son-in-law Jeffrey; sister Ivona; niece Jessica and her family Drew, Braxton, and Brayden; and lifelong best friend Linda.
